Synopsis
Justine: A Matter of Innocence is a 1980 drama film that explores the intricate and often conflicting themes of innocence, desire, and morality. The story follows Justine, played by Hillary Summers, as she navigates a world filled with complex relationships and moral dilemmas. Set against a backdrop that combines both sensuality and psychological depth, the film takes a raw and sometimes controversial look at human behavior and societal norms. Through its evocative narrative and character-driven plot, Justine delves into the challenges of maintaining innocence in a world rife with temptation and corruption, ultimately questioning the nature of purity and guilt.

Reviews
Justine: A Matter of Innocence has received mixed reviews from critics and audiences alike. On IMDb, the film holds a rating of 5.1/10, reflecting a divided response. Some viewers appreciated the film's ambitious exploration of controversial themes and praised Hillary Summers' committed performance. Critics have noted the film's atmospheric cinematography and its attempt to delve into complex psychological issues, which some consider a bold artistic choice. However, many reviews also highlight pacing issues and a narrative that can feel disjointed or difficult to follow. The film's explicit content and mature themes led to polarized opinionsโsome viewing it as a compelling drama while others saw it as exploitative. Mainstream review aggregators such as Rotten Tomatoes and Metacritic do not have extensive data on this title, indicating the movie's niche status and limited release. Overall, Justine is regarded as a film that might appeal to viewers interested in 1980s European-style adult dramas but may challenge or alienate others with its tone and subject matter.
